技术文摘
在 Vue 项目里点击 DOM 实现 VSCode 代码行自动定位的方法
在 Vue 项目里点击 DOM 实现 VSCode 代码行自动定位的方法
在 Vue 项目开发中,为了提高开发效率和调试的便利性,实现点击 DOM 元素时能够自动定位到对应的 VSCode 代码行是一个非常实用的功能。下面将详细介绍实现这一功能的方法。
我们需要在 Vue 项目中引入相关的依赖。可以使用一些前端库来处理 DOM 操作和与 VSCode 的通信。
接下来,在组件的代码中,通过添加事件监听来捕获 DOM 元素的点击事件。当点击发生时,获取相关的元素信息,例如组件名称、元素的标识等。
然后,利用通信机制将这些信息传递给后端服务或者本地的脚本。这可以通过 HTTP 请求或者本地的进程间通信来实现。
在后端服务或脚本中,根据接收到的元素信息,解析并找到对应的代码文件和行号。
为了准确地定位到代码行,需要在项目的构建过程中生成相应的映射文件,记录组件、元素与代码行的对应关系。
之后,使用 VSCode 提供的 API 或者命令行接口,将解析得到的代码行信息传递给 VSCode,从而实现自动定位。
在实际实现过程中,还需要处理一些异常情况,比如代码文件的移动或重命名,以及映射关系的更新等。
另外,为了提高性能和用户体验,对通信过程进行优化也是很重要的。可以采用缓存机制,避免重复的计算和请求。
通过以上步骤,就能够在 Vue 项目中成功实现点击 DOM 元素时,在 VSCode 中自动定位到对应的代码行。这将极大地提高开发人员的工作效率,减少在代码中查找对应部分的时间和精力,让开发过程更加流畅和高效。
利用现代前端技术和工具,结合合理的架构设计和优化策略,我们能够轻松实现这一便捷的功能,为 Vue 项目开发带来更好的体验。
TAGS: Vue 项目 DOM 操作 技术实现方法 VSCode 代码定位